如何自学编程 需要什么
-
自学编程的方法有很多,下面我将给出一些指导,帮助您开始自学编程,并且了解您需要准备什么。
一、选择编程语言
首先,您需要选择一门编程语言作为起点。目前比较常用的编程语言有Python、Java、JavaScript等。选择一门广泛应用且易于学习的编程语言可以帮助您更好地入门。二、获取学习资源
自学编程的过程中,学习资源是非常关键的。您可以通过以下途径获取学习资源:- 网络教程:例如在线编程平台、视频教程、编程博客等。
- 书籍:购买编程书籍,学习其中的知识。可以选择适合初学者的入门书籍。
- 社区和论坛:加入编程社区或论坛,与其他编程爱好者交流学习经验,解决问题。
三、制定学习计划
自学编程需要有一个合理的学习计划,帮助您系统地学习知识。可以按照以下步骤进行:- 先从基础知识入手,了解编程语言的基本概念、语法和常见的数据结构和算法。
- 掌握常用的编程工具,如代码编辑器和集成开发环境(IDE)。
- 多实践,通过编写小程序或者参与开源项目来熟悉实际开发过程。
- 不断扩展学习范围,学习与编程相关的其他知识领域,如数据库、网络编程等。
四、坚持练习
自学编程需要坚持练习,通过实际编写代码来巩固知识和提高编程能力。可以通过以下方式进行练习:- 解决编程题目:尝试解决一些编程题目,例如LeetCode上的算法题目,来提升编程思维和逻辑能力。
- 开发实践项目:尝试开发一些实际应用,通过实际项目来熟悉编程过程和开发流程。
五、参与编程社区
加入编程社区可以与其他编程爱好者交流学习经验,获取更多的学习资源和灵感。可以加入GitHub、Stack Overflow等社区,积极参与讨论。在学习编程过程中,还需要具备以下必备条件:
- 一台可以运行编程软件的电脑。
- 网络连接,用于获取学习资源和与其他编程爱好者交流。
- 学习的耐心和毅力,因为自学编程需要时间和精力的投入。
总结起来,自学编程的关键是选择好的学习资源、制定合理的学习计划,并坚持练习和参与编程社区。准备好所需的硬件和软件条件,同时要具备学习的耐心和毅力。祝您在自学编程的道路上取得成功!
1年前 -
自学编程是一种常见的学习方式,以下是一些关键的步骤和需要的资源:
-
确定学习目标:在开始学习前,明确你想要学习的编程语言或领域。常见的编程语言包括Python、Java、C++等。此外,还可以选择学习Web开发、移动应用开发、数据科学等不同的编程领域。
-
选择学习资源:有许多免费和付费的学习资源可供选择。一些常见的学习资源包括在线教程、视频课程、书籍、编程网站和论坛等。一些知名的学习平台如Codecademy、Coursera、Udemy等提供了丰富的学习资源。
-
学习基础知识:编程的基础知识包括数据类型、变量、条件语句、循环语句、函数等概念。可以通过阅读教程、观看视频课程或者参加在线编程课程来学习这些基础知识。
-
实践编程:编程学习最关键的部分是进行实践。通过解决实际问题、完成编程练习和项目来巩固所学内容。可以通过自己构思项目,或者参加开源项目来获得实践经验。
-
加入编程社区:与其他编程学习者和专业程序员互动,参加编程社区可以帮助你分享经验、解决问题和获得更多的学习资源。可以加入在线编程论坛、社交媒体群组或者参加编程活动来扩展你的网络。
此外,还需要一些基本的工具和软件来进行编程学习,如代码编辑器(如Sublime Text、Visual Studio Code等)、运行环境(如Python解释器、Apache服务器等)、版本控制工具(如Git)、调试工具等。具体使用哪些工具或软件可以根据你所选择的编程语言和领域来决定。
总结起来,要自学编程,首先需要明确学习目标,选择适合自己的学习资源,掌握基础知识,进行实践,加入编程社区,并准备好一些必要的工具和软件。不断地学习和实践,你将逐渐掌握编程技能并提升自己。
1年前 -
-
自学编程对于许多人来说是一种经济有效的方式,可以在自己的时间和自己的步调下学习。对于想要自学编程的初学者来说,以下是一些方法和操作流程。
一、准备工作
在自学编程之前,需要做一些准备工作。1.明确学习目标:
首先,明确学习编程的具体目标。是想要学习前端开发、后端开发、移动应用开发还是数据分析等。确定目标后,可以更有针对性地选择学习内容和学习资源。2.选择编程语言:
根据自己的目标选择一门编程语言进行学习。常见的编程语言包括Python、JavaScript、Java、C++等。可以通过了解各个编程语言的特点和应用领域,选择最适合自己的一门语言。3.准备学习资源:
在自学编程过程中,需要准备一些学习资源,如教材、教程、在线课程、编程练习平台等。这些资源可以帮助你系统地学习编程知识,并提供实践机会。二、学习方法
自学编程需要掌握一些学习方法,以提高学习效果。1.理论学习与实践结合:
编程是一门实践性很强的学科,理论学习只是入门的一部分。建议将理论学习与实践相结合,通过编写代码、解决问题和完成项目来巩固所学知识。2.项目驱动学习:
选择一个小型项目作为练手项目,在实际的编程实践中学习和解决问题。通过完成一个完整的项目,不仅可以锻炼编程能力,还可以提升解决问题和独立思考的能力。3.参与编程社区:
加入编程社区,参与讨论和交流。在社区中可以向经验丰富的开发者请教问题,分享学习心得和经验。编程社区是一个学习、成长和获取资源的宝贵平台。三、操作流程
以下是一个基本的自学编程的操作流程,可以根据个人情况进行调整。1.基础知识学习:
首先,通过阅读教材、教程或参加在线课程等学习编程的基础知识。学习基本的语法、数据结构、算法等。2.编程练习:
在掌握了一定的基础知识后,进行编程练习。可以使用在线编程练习平台,从简单到复杂地完成一系列编程练习。练习的过程中可以通过查阅文档和解决问题的思考和实践中获得进一步的学习和提高。3.项目实践:
选择一个小型项目作为练手项目,并逐步完成项目。在项目实践的过程中,会遇到各种问题和挑战,需要通过自主学习、查阅文档、寻找解决方案等来解决。4.持续学习和提高:
编程是一个不断学习和提高的过程。持续学习新的知识和技术,了解行业的最新动态,并不断通过实践来提高自己的编程能力。需要注意的是,自学编程需要坚持和耐心,同时也需要不断纠正错误和改正思维方式。通过不断学习和实践,相信能够掌握一门编程语言并应用于实际开发中。
1年前